This area shows that a bathroom's tile style can take a star turn, even in a small area. Graphic black-and-white patterned cement tile offers character and an undeniable wow element. Pattern most likely isn't the very first thing that comes to mind as a perfect tile for restroom floors, especially if it's a little space.

Keep the rest of the primary elements basic and include the colors in the pattern somewhere else. The product is porous, so like marble, giving extra diligence to spills and standing water is a must.
